Guska na turopoljski is a traditional dish originating from the Turopolje area. This festive dish is usually made with a combination of a whole goose, salt, and oil or pork fat. The goose is washed, seasoned with salt, and placed in a deep and wide baking pan.
Heated pork fat or oil is poured over the goose, and the bird is then roasted in the oven while being occasionally basted with the pan juices. While the goose is in the oven, a side dish consisting of goose gizzard and liver, oil, onions, garlic, salt, cloves, paprika, black pepper, and polenta flour.
